    Pink Candy Wafer Melts

    Where can you buy Candy Wafter Melts?

    Candy Wafter Melts can be purchased at your Super Grocery Store during the holidays or they can be purchased at a party supply store or near the Wilton Supply Area of your Craft and Hobby Store.

    Pink Wafter Melts in Instant Pot

    Instant Pot Melting Chocolate Directions

    Using your Instant Pot as a double broiler makes melting wafer candy a breeze. Add 5-6 cups of water and set to Saute'.

    Allow the water to heat up and the steam will melt the Candy Wafters placed in a bowl above the water. It's the easiest way I have found to melt chocolate without scorching it.

    Quick Tip

    When using your Instant Pot or Pressure Cooker as a double Broiler, be careful of the steam.

    It can burn you. Once the wafter candy is melted you can turn your Instant Pot Off or to Warm and your wafers will remain melted for long enough to dip your cookies.

    Ingredients

    • 40 Pkg Family OREO Cookies approx 40 cookies
    • 8 ounces Pkg Pink Wafer Melts
    • 1 Sm Bottle Valentine Sprinkles

    Instructions

    • Add 5-6 Cups water to your Instant Pot and set to Saute.
    • Place a larger bowl over the top of your Instant Pot and add Pink Wafer Melts
    • The Steam created will melt the wafer candy. Stir as it's melting until smooth
    • Dip ½ of each OREO into the melted candy and place cookie on Wax Paper on a cookie sheet to cool
    • Sprinkle Valentine Sprinkles on dipped cookies and allow to fully cool before serving
